Title: Innovations by Vineet Abhishek
Introduction
Vineet Abhishek is a notable inventor based in Mountain View, CA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of technology, particularly in search algorithms and data processing. With a total of five patents to his name, his work continues to influence the way search results are generated and displayed.
Latest Patents
Vineet's latest patents include innovative systems and methods for interleaving search results. These systems utilize one or more processors and non-transitory storage devices to execute computing instructions. The technology is designed to create combined search results from multiple searching algorithms, enhancing the user experience by providing more relevant results. The patents detail processes for ranking search results, storing user interactions, and determining the traffic impact of each result, showcasing a sophisticated approach to search technology.
Career Highlights
Vineet Abhishek is currently employed at Walmart Apollo, LLC, where he applies his expertise in search algorithms and data processing. His work at Walmart Apollo reflects his commitment to advancing technology and improving user interactions with search engines. His innovative contributions have positioned him as a key player in the tech industry.
Collaborations
Vineet has collaborated with talented individuals such as Onur Gungor and Shie Mannor. These collaborations have allowed him to enhance his projects and contribute to the development of cutting-edge technologies.
